Northfield Conference Meeting

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

A meeting for all men interested in the summer student conference at Northfield will be held in the Parlor of Phillips Brooks House this evening at 8 o'clock.

Addresses will be made by Professor P. M. Rhinelander and Rev. Albert Parker Fitch '00, President of the Andover Theological Seminary. After these speeches a general informal discussion of plans for the Harvard delegation will be held. Refreshments will be served.

All members of the University who are interested in this movement, whether or not they are members of the Phillips Brooks House Association, are cordially invited.
